Inserting Symbols into a Clue
To offer greater flexibility, PuzzleMaker lets you insert symbols into your clues. By using symbols in your clues, you
can create mathematical equations, or insert special symbols. After you have
chosen the option to Edit a vocabulary database from the main menu, follow the steps below to insert symbols into your clues.
To insert symbols into your clues:
- Highlight the word that you want to insert the symbols into and click the
Edit button. Or you can click the Add button if you will be
inserting symbols into the clue field of a new word.
- Within the clue field, place your cursor where you want to insert a symbol,
and click your left mouse button.
- Click the Symbol button.
- Click the symbol you want to insert into the clue. Click the Insert
button to place it in the clue.
- Click Done to return to the Edit Record or Add Word
dialog box.
Special symbols cannot be used in a word because the symbols cannot be typed
by the students while they complete puzzles. The student can, however, type
the name of the symbol in place of the symbol itself. Examples include:
can be typed as pi,
can be typed as division, and © can be
typed as copyright.
